How to Make This Recipe Easy Peasy
INGREDIENTS
- 1 cup unsalted butter, softened
- 1 cup brown sugar, packed
- 1 large egg
- 2 teaspoons vanilla extract
- 2 1/2 cups all-purpose flour
- 1 teaspoon baking soda
- 1/2 teaspoon salt
- 2 teaspoons ground cinnamon
INSTRUCTIONS
-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C) and line baking sheets with parchment paper. This ensures your cookies bake evenly and cleanup is a breeze.
- In a large bowl, cream together the softened butter and brown sugar until light and fluffy. This step is crucial for texture; take your time to ensure the mixture is well-aerated.
- Beat in the egg and vanilla extract until well combined. These ingredients add richness and depth of flavor.
- In a separate bowl, whisk together the flour, baking soda, salt, and ground cinnamon. Whisking helps to evenly distribute the baking soda and cinnamon, ensuring consistent flavor in every bite.
- Gradually add the dry ingredients to the wet mixture, mixing just until combined. Be careful not to overmix, which can lead to tough cookies.
- Roll the dough into 1-inch balls and place them 2 inches apart on the prepared baking sheets. This spacing allows the cookies to spread without merging into each other.
- Flatten each cookie slightly with the palm of your hand or the bottom of a glass. This helps them bake evenly and achieve the desired texture.
- Bake for 10-12 minutes or until the edges are set and just beginning to brown. Keep a close eye on them to avoid overbaking.
- Allow cookies to cool on the baking sheet for 5 minutes before transferring to a wire rack to cool completely. This helps them set properly while retaining their chewy centers.
Difficulty: Easy • Cuisine: American • Preparation Time: 15 minutes • Cooking Time: 12 minutes • Total Time: 27 minutes • Calories: 180 kcal • Servings: 24 cookies
Note: Use softened butter for easier creaming and better cookie texture. Sift the cinnamon with flour to distribute the spice evenly throughout the dough. This ensures that every bite bursts with cinnamon flavor.

Storage Tips and How to Enjoy Leftovers the Easy Peasy Way
To keep your cookies fresh and delicious, follow these easy-peasy storage tips:
- Airtight Container: Store your cookies in an airtight container at room temperature for up to a week. This prevents them from getting stale or absorbing moisture.
- Freezing: These cookies freeze wonderfully! Place them in a zip-top bag and freeze for up to three months. To enjoy, simply thaw at room temperature. This is a great way to always have a sweet treat on hand.
- Refreshing Leftovers: Warm them in a low oven for a few minutes to recapture that just-baked aroma and texture. This trick brings back the fresh-baked feel and enhances the flavors.
- Creative Use: Crumble over yogurt or use as a base for a no-bake dessert crust. These cookies can add a delightful crunch and flavor to other desserts, making them versatile beyond just snacking.
